0

と の間にパフォーマンスの違いは!=あり<>ますか?

おまけ:!=の代わりにを使用すると、人々が動揺するのはなぜ<>ですか? もちろん、私はすべてのプログラマーがこれに腹を立てていると推測していますが、現在、私は 2 つの会社で働いており、その会社は<>

4

2 に答える 2

2

簡単な答え: いいえ、パフォーマンスに違いはありません。

!=おまけの質問ですが、SQL 92 標準で定義されておらず、移植性が低いため、人々は動揺していると思います。

編集

SQL 92 標準はこちらで見つけることができ、次のように不等号演算子を定義しています。

<not equals operator> ::= <>
于 2013-11-03T21:49:05.810 に答える
1

それらにはパフォーマンスの違いはありません。それは確かに標準/一貫性の問題です。この質問を見てください: TSQL で等しくない場合に != または <> を使用する必要がありますか?

于 2013-11-03T22:04:58.477 に答える